Echoes of Bronze Santiago De Querétaro, Mexico

A multinational collaboration project, Echoes of Bronze is inspired by the legacy of the Bronze Age mythos and heroic values that ripple throughout history.

Our first album, ILIUM retells the Trojan war epic as a metal opera, combining melodic storytelling vocals with heavy metal to deliver a dramatic and nostalgic experience about rage, glory and the cost of war.
